Crime overview

High Meadow Road area has the 18th highest crime rate of 39 local areas in Druids Heath & Monyhull , and the 1358th highest crime rate of 3,059 local areas in Birmingham .

Crime levels at this postcode are much higher than in the adjoining streets, suggesting that most neighbouring areas are relatively safer than this one.

The overall crime rate in the area around High Meadow Road (B38 9AR) in the last 12 months was 97.7 per 1,000 residents and was 9.4% higher than the Druids Heath & Monyhull average (89.4 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 15 offences recorded. The least common crime was Burglary with 1 case , down -50.0% compared to 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Criminal damage and arson ( 50.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Burglary ( -50.0% YoY).

Violent crimes totalled 20 (≈ 65.1 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were rising ( 17.6%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-47.2% comparing early vs recent averages) .

In the area around High Meadow Road (B38 9AR), the highest concentration of overall crime is near Supermarket, where police recorded 86 incidents. Violent and public-order offences occur most often near Wharf Road (30 offences). Both locations lie within roughly 0.3 miles of this postcode area.
